The TMS320F280260DAS is a digital signal controller (DSC) belonging to the TMS320F2802x series by Texas Instruments. The TMS320F280260DAS features a 100-pin LQFP package with specific pin assignments for various functions, including GPIO, communication interfaces, analog inputs, and power supply connections. A detailed pinout diagram is available in the product datasheet.
The TMS320F280260DAS operates on the principle of real-time control, utilizing its high-performance CPU core and integrated peripherals to execute control algorithms and interface with external systems. It leverages its digital signal processing capabilities to perform complex computations required for control applications.
The TMS320F280260DAS is well-suited for a wide range of applications, including: - Motor Control: Brushless DC motors, permanent magnet synchronous motors - Digital Power Conversion: Inverters, converters, power supplies - Real-Time Control Systems: Industrial automation, robotics, automotive control
In conclusion, the TMS320F280260DAS is a powerful digital signal controller designed for high-performance control applications. With its integrated peripherals, advanced control capabilities, and flexible development environment, it serves as a versatile solution for real-time control systems.
